構(gòu)造代碼塊,是為了書寫便利。 有些方法在對(duì)象創(chuàng)建的時(shí)候就希望可以擁有。好比每一個(gè)孩子出生需要哭,哭就類似于孩子的本能。這就類似于構(gòu)造代碼塊,每個(gè)...
何時(shí)使用封裝:在編程中如果遇到【實(shí)體類】,生活中實(shí)際存在的類,通常就會(huì)被這個(gè)類當(dāng)中的數(shù)據(jù)全部私有化private。代碼中,程序只會(huì)嚴(yán)格的執(zhí)行數(shù)據(jù)...
javap -c -l -private ***.class -c 反編譯的選擇-l 顯示行號(hào)和本地變量-private 顯示所有類和成員***...
在生活中,不可能一個(gè)類組成一個(gè)方法,比如汽車壞了,是需要送到修理廠的;電視機(jī),電腦壞了,也是需要找一個(gè)器修廠的。Java中也是一樣的,一個(gè)類對(duì)應(yīng)...
【構(gòu)造函數(shù)】 對(duì)于構(gòu)造函數(shù)來說,參數(shù)的傳遞是最重要的,因?yàn)闃?gòu)造函數(shù)的函數(shù)名與類名一致,也沒有返回值,那么構(gòu)造函數(shù)別的不同也就只有參數(shù)了,所以唯...
在Java中有些類創(chuàng)建之后就是調(diào)用了某個(gè)方法一次,之后再也不使用,這樣會(huì)導(dǎo)致資源浪費(fèi),以及代碼的臃腫Java提供了一種方式:匿名對(duì)象匿名對(duì)象的格...
上面已經(jīng)說過了創(chuàng)建對(duì)象的方法,但為了規(guī)整性并沒有進(jìn)行過多的描述。 創(chuàng)建對(duì)象,對(duì)象空間成員變量的默認(rèn)值SuperHero sh = new Sup...
eclipse是之后開始使用的一個(gè)軟件,進(jìn)行一些初步的使用。 首先是設(shè)置工作路徑 【要求】工作路徑中不能有任何的中文 創(chuàng)建Java工程的過程:1...